Flora cuisine does not actively lower cholesterol. It is marketed as "lower in saturated fat than olive oil", which is true, because flora cuisine is primarily made from sunflower oil. This implies that it will raise your cholesterol "less than olive oil will" - but does not lower your cholesterol.

Flora cuisine is also marketed as "a natural source of Omega 3 and 6" (which is from the proportion of linseed oil in it), however if you are consuming enough Flora Cuisine oil to actually use it as a source of Omega 3's and 6's, you're consuming far too much of it.

There is no real benefit from switching from using olive oil / sunflower oil to using Flora cuisine, since you shouldn't really be consuming oil in the quantities that would make switching worthwhile (e.g if you're only using about a tablespoon of oil or less in the average day, there's no real benefit to switching). Flora Cuisine is still oil, it is not a healthfood and does not actively lower your cholesterol. To lower cholesterol, it's more effective to reduce the total amount of oil in your diet rather than switch to something that appears "healthier".

Is flora cuisine good for blood pressure?

Flora cuisine does not actively lower blood pressure. It is marketed as "lower in saturated fat than olive oil", which is beneficial to the heart and supposedly blood pressure, by association. However the lower saturated fat is because Flora Cuisine is primarily sunflower oil, not because Flora Cuisine is some sort of "miracle oil". Any type of oil is not good for you if you eat too much of it, Flora Cuisine included - you shouldn't' really be eating enough oil anyway to benefit from switching to Flora Cuisine, since that amount of oil is not part of a healthy diet.
